Convert Hectares (ha) to Square Kilometers (km²)

Converting hectares (ha) to square kilometers (km²) is straightforward with the conversion factor of 1 ha = 0.01 km². This conversion is particularly useful in agriculture, land management, and urban planning, where precise area measurements are essential.

Conversion Formula

km² = ha × 0.01

Reverse: ha = km² × 100

Quick mental math: To quickly estimate, remember that 100 ha is about 1 km².

Unit Definitions

What is a Hectare (ha)?

Metric (SI)Worldwide

A hectare (ha) is a metric unit of area equal to 10,000 square meters, commonly used in land measurement.

History

The hectare was introduced in 1795 as a unit for land measurement and has been widely adopted in agriculture and forestry. The term is derived from the French 'aire' meaning 'area' and the metric prefix 'hecto' meaning 100.

Current Use

Hectares are predominantly used in countries that utilize the metric system, especially in agriculture, forestry, and land planning.

What is a Square Kilometer (km²)?

Metric (SI)Worldwide

A square kilometer (km²) is a unit of area equal to one kilometer by one kilometer, or 1,000,000 square meters.

History

The square kilometer has been used since the metric system was established in the late 18th century. It is a standard unit of measure in global land area calculations.

Current Use

Square kilometers are commonly used for measuring larger areas, such as cities, states, and countries, providing a clear understanding of significant land sizes.

What is the relationship between hectares and square kilometers?
The relationship is defined by the conversion factor where 1 hectare equals 0.01 square kilometers. Therefore, to convert any number of hectares to square kilometers, you simply multiply by 0.01. For instance, if you have 800 hectares, it converts to 8 km², which is ideal for assessing large tracts of land.
